Margaret C. Duhn

Print

Margaret C. Duhn, 93, of Oxford, formerly of Pleasant Ridge, died Thursday, Jan. 3, 2008, at Pontiac Osteopathic Hospital. She was born June 27, 1914, in Mobile, Ala. Mrs. Duhn was a member of the Daughters of the American Revolution and St. Mary's Catholic Church, Royal Oak. She retired from Credit Union One, Ferndale. She was predeceased by her husband, Gilbert S. Duhn, on July 10, 1992. Surviving are her children, Gilbert Jr. of Harrison Township, Peggy (Richard) Reddaway of Oxford, Dorothy (Rudy) Mackey of Oak Park, Jennie (Kevin) Sutherland of Royal Oak, Elizabeth of Oak Park, Patricia of Pleasant Ridge, and an adopted daughter, Neddie of Pleasant Ridge; siblings, Jennie Cassidy and Gene (Doris) Cox of Mobile, Ala.; sisters-in-law, Mary Lois Cox of Kansas City, Mo., Gladys Smith, Elaine Horn Duhn and Joyce Duhn; grandchildren, Jim, Brian, Kim, John, Morgan and Anne Marie; and great-grandchildren, Samantha, Amanda, Josh, Lauren, Ian and one due in April. Visitation, 3-9 p.m. today at Wessels & Wilk Funeral Home, 23690 Woodward Ave., Pleasant Ridge; in state, 9:30 a.m. Saturday until 10 a.m. Mass is celebrated at St. Mary's Catholic Church, at Lafayette and Lincoln avenues, Royal Oak, with Fr. Steve officiating; interment, Lakeview Cemetery; memorials, Huntington's Disease Society of American Michigan Chapter; www.wesselsandwilk.com.

Published in The Daily Tribune on January 4, 2008.
